package org.apache.logging.log4j.core.parser;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.DeserializationFeature;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.ObjectMapper;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.ObjectReader;
import org.apache.logging.log4j.core.LogEvent;
import org.apache.logging.log4j.core.impl.Log4jLogEvent;
import java.io.IOException;
public class AbstractJacksonLogEventParser implements TextLogEventParser {
private final ObjectReader objectReader;
protected AbstractJacksonLogEventParser(final ObjectMapper objectMapper) {
objectMapper.configure(DeserializationFeature.FAIL_ON_UNKNOWN_PROPERTIES, false);
this.objectReader = objectMapper.readerFor(Log4jLogEvent.class);
}
@Override
public LogEvent parseFrom(final String input) throws ParseException {
try {
return objectReader.readValue(input);
} catch (final IOException e) {
throw new ParseException(e);
}
}
@Override
public LogEvent parseFrom(final byte[] input) throws ParseException {
try {
return objectReader.readValue(input);
} catch (final IOException e) {
throw new ParseException(e);
}
}
@Override
public LogEvent parseFrom(final byte[] input, final int offset, final int length) throws ParseException {
try {
return objectReader.readValue(input, offset, length);
} catch (final IOException e) {
throw new ParseException(e);
}
}
}
